MEAN Stack Development

Learn the Coding Languages and Platforms Employers Look For

Looking to enhance your programming skills? Dive into the coding languages and platforms that top employers are seeking! Whether you're a seasoned developer or just starting, our comprehensive courses will help you master the in-demand technologies that drive innovation. Stay ahead of the curve by learning the skills that companies value most. Don't just learn to code—learn what employers are looking for, and pave your path to success with confidence.

MEAN Stack Development

MEAN Stack Development

MEAN stack development is a free and open source technology used to build web applications that are both quick and sustainable. Built for the cloud, MEAN stack development is a free JavaScript app that keeps memory overhead low.

MEAN stack development can be used for news aggregation sites, interactive forums, workflow management tools, and calendar applications. Integration, while it is simple based on the JavaScript platform, does encounter performance problems. At the same time, the 3-tier approach makes it secure enough for most applications.

Request Information

Navigating programming languages by yourself can be challenging. If you’re wondering if learning MEAN Stack Development is right for you or you need help getting started on another path, we’re here to help.

Enrollment Deadline - March 8th, 2025

*By submitting this form, you are giving your express written consent for California Institute of Applied Technology to contact you regarding our educational programs and services using email, telephone or text – including use of automated technology for calls and periodic texts to any wireless number you provide. Message and data rates may apply. This consent is not required to purchase goods or services and you may always call us directly at 877-559-3621. You can opt-out any time by calling us or responding STOP to any text message.

MEAN Stack Development FAQs

The MEAN in MEAN stack development stands for:

  • MongoDB

    Which is the popular NoSQL database that stores data in a JSON format.

  • Express.je

    The flexible and minimal web framework for Node.js.

  • Angular

    Responsible for creating dynamic web applications through a JavaScript framework.

  • Node.js

    The runtime environment responsible for executing JavaScript outside the browser.

Learning MEAN Stack Development is a strategic career move with many benefits. By mastering MEAN Stack, individuals gain a comprehensive skill set highly sought after in the tech industry. MEAN developers are equipped to design, develop, and deploy dynamic web applications, making them indispensable in today's digital landscape. Moreover, proficiency in MEAN Stack opens doors to many career opportunities and advancement possibilities, as companies actively seek professionals with this expertise. Whether you're a seasoned developer looking to upskill or a newcomer aiming to enter the tech industry, learning MEAN Stack Development is a great way to propel your career forward.

Before diving into MEAN Stack Development, having a basic understanding of the following technical skills can be beneficial:

  • Debugging and Problem-Solving Skills
  • JavaScript
  • HTML/CSS
  • Command Line Basics

While these skills are not mandatory prerequisites for learning MEAN Stack Development, having a basic understanding of them can make your learning journey easier.

MEAN Stack Development skills can open up a wide range of job opportunities across various industries. Here are some types of jobs you can pursue with MEAN Stack Development expertise:

  • Full Stack Developer
  • Software Developer
  • Mobile App Developer
  • Android Developer
  • iOS Developer
  • Front-end Developer
  • Web Developer
  • Java Software Engineer
  • Chief Technical Officer
  • Interface Engineer
  • Application Developer

These are just a few examples, and there are many other career paths where MEAN Stack Development skills can be beneficial. As MEAN Stack Development continues to grow in popularity and usage, the demand for professionals with MEAN Stack Development expertise is expected to remain strong.

The time it takes to learn MEAN stack development can vary widely depending on individual learning styles, prior experience, and the depth of understanding desired. Generally, someone with a basic understanding of web development concepts could become proficient in MEAN stack development within 6 to 12 months of dedicated study and practice. However, to truly master the intricacies of each technology and be able to build complex, scalable applications, it may take several years of consistent learning and hands-on experience.

The career outlook for MEAN Stack Development remains promising, reflecting the ongoing demand for skilled professionals in web development. MEAN Stack's versatility and efficiency in building dynamic, scalable web applications have made it a popular choice among developers and organizations. As businesses continue to emphasize online presence and user experience, proficiency in MEAN Stack development offers a competitive edge. Job opportunities range from junior developer roles to senior positions, with salaries varying based on experience, location, and company size. Continuous learning and keeping up with industry trends are crucial for MEAN Stack developers to stay relevant and advance their careers in this dynamic field.

Have more questions? Reach out today and admissions advisor will answer any other questions you have!

Request Info

Address

401 Mile of Cars Way #100, National City, CA 91950

Phone

(877) 559-3621

California Institute of Applied Technology Logo

© 2025 California Institute of Applied Technology | info@ciat.edu | (877) 559 - 3621 | Privacy Policy

GI Bill® is a registered trademark of the U.S. Department of Veterans Affairs (VA). More information about education benefits offered by VA is available at the official U.S. government website at https://www.benefits.va.gov/gibill. CIAT is approved to offer VA benefits. *Financial aid is available for those who qualify. *Students are encouraged to take certification exams while actively enrolled in their Certificate or Degree program. Unlimited certification exam attempts expire 180 days after graduation. Select exams are not eligible for unlimited retakes - see certification exam policy for details. Certifications or courses may change to address industry trends or improve quality

Start a Chat